salmagundi
noun
/ˌsæl.məˈɡʌn.di/

Definition
A dish made of various ingredients, often served as a salad or a mixture of different kinds of food.

Examples
- The chef prepared a colorful salmagundi of seasonal vegetables.
- At the potluck, everyone brought a salmagundi of their favorite dishes.
- Her newsletter was a salmagundi of local news, recipes, and personal anecdotes.

Meaning
In a broader sense, salmagundi refers to a mix of diverse elements or a hodgepodge.

Synonyms
- medley
- hodgepodge
- mixture
- assortment
